The Art of Bedouin Silver Jewellery
Bedouin silver jewelry is often constructed from sterling silver, that's frequently sourced domestically or traded with neighboring tribes. The artisans use classic methods for instance repoussé, engraving, and filigree to produce intricate designs that happen to be the two purposeful and aesthetically pleasing. Prevalent motifs consist of geometric designs, stars, crescents, and symbols symbolizing nature, for instance camels, palm trees, as well as the Sunshine.
Bedouin Tribes as well as their Jewelry
The Bedouin tribes of Egypt and North Africa, including the Rashaida tribes south of Egypt, Each individual have their own personal unique types of jewellery. The jewellery worn by women typically demonstrates their social position, marital status, and personal preferences. One example is, a bride may dress in elaborate necklaces and earrings adorned with treasured stones, though a married woman might use less difficult parts that are a lot more functional for everyday life.
Egyptian Bedouin:
Noted for their Daring and colourful jewellery, Egyptian Bedouin generally integrate turquoise, coral, and various gemstones into their designs. Their necklaces and earrings tend to be huge and statement-creating, reflecting the vibrant culture of the Nile Valley.
North African Bedouin:
Bedouin tribes in North Africa, including the Tuareg, have a far more minimalist sort of jewellery. Their items are frequently manufactured with intricate filigree operate and therefore are created to be relaxed and realistic for all times from the desert.
Rashaida Bedouin:
The Rashaida tribes, who inhabit the Purple Sea coast, have a distinctive style of jewellery that includes equally Bedouin and Sudanese influences. Their pieces frequently feature Daring geometric designs and are adorned with vibrant beads and shells.
